How to Fill Out Form 990:

01
Gather all required information: Before starting the form, collect all necessary details such as the organization's name, address, EIN (Employer Identification Number), financial statements, program descriptions, and governance information.
02
Understand the sections: Form 990 is divided into several sections, including identifying information, exempt status, program service accomplishments, financial information, and governance. Familiarize yourself with each section to ensure you provide accurate information.
03
Complete Part I: In Part I, provide basic information about your organization, including its name, address, EIN, the type of return, accounting method used, and other details as required. Fill in all the necessary fields accurately.
04
Proceed to Part II: In this section, provide the organization's mission statement and make sure it clearly describes your nonprofit's purpose and activities. Additionally, include information about your programs, beneficiaries, and any changes made since the last filing.
05
Complete Part III: Part III focuses on the organization's statement of program service accomplishments. Describe the significant activities undertaken during the year and demonstrate how they meet your organization's mission. Provide quantitative and qualitative information, such as the number of individuals served or the impact of your programs.
06
Fill in Part IV: This section pertains to the organization's financial details. Report your rev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and net assets accurately. If needed, attach additional schedules or statements for detailed explanations.
07
Proceed to Part V: Part V requires information about the organization's governance, management, and policies. Provide details about your officers, directors, and key employees. Include their names, titles, hours worked, and compensation.
08
Complete the remaining sections: Continue filling out the subsequent sections of Form 990, ensuring accuracy and completeness. Carefully review your responses before moving to the next section.
09
Attach required schedules: Some organizations may need to attach additional schedules to provide further details about certain aspects of their operations. For example, Schedule A is required for organizations claiming public charity status, and Schedule B discloses contributions from specific donors.
10
Review and sign: Once you have filled out all the sections, carefully review the entire form to ensure accuracy. Sign and date the form as required.

Who Needs to File Form 990:

01
Nonprofit organizations: Form 990 must be filed by most tax-exempt organizations, including public charities, private foundations, and certain nonexempt charitable trusts.
02
Large nonprofits: Organizations with gross receipts exceeding $200,000 or total assets above $500,000 are generally required to file Form 990.
03
Other exempt organizations: Some exempt organizations, such as political organizations, social clubs, and religious organizations, have different filing requirements. Make sure to consult the instructions or a tax professional to determine the correct form to file.
Remember, this is a general overview, and specific instructions and requirements can vary based on individual circumstances. It's always recommended to consult the official instructions provided by the IRS or seek professional advice to ensure accurate and compliant completion of Form 990.

Form 990 is used by tax-exempt organizations to provide the IRS with information on their finances and activities.
Most tax-exempt organizations, including charities, foundations, and other nonprofits, are required to file Form 990.
Form 990 can be filled out online or by mail, and organizations must provide information on their finances, activities, and governance.
The purpose of Form 990 is to provide the public and the IRS with information on an organization's finances and activities.
Information on an organization's revenue, expenses, assets, activities, and governance must be reported on Form 990.
